Henry County clay is no joke. It holds moisture in ways that northern Georgia soil doesn't, which means natural grass either stays waterlogged or cracks during dry spells. Artificial turf eliminates that frustration entirely. Most Stockbridge properties sit on quarter-acre to half-acre lots, which is the sweet spot for synthetic lawns—large enough to make a real visual impact, manageable enough for a professional install in a day or two. Sun exposure varies significantly depending on whether your home is in Eagles Landing (often tree-dense) or the more open Reeves Creek developments. We assess shade patterns during the site visit because certain turf products perform better in low-light conditions. One thing we always mention: Stockbridge's rapid growth rate means your neighbors' natural lawns might look overgrown by mid-week, but yours stays picture-perfect. Installation here typically involves removing the existing sod, amending the base with proper drainage (crucial given our clay), and laying down premium turf with infill. The whole process accounts for our humidity and occasional heavy rain—drainage is not an afterthought in our designs.
Yes, but preparation is key. We remove the existing grass and work with the clay base by adding a drainage layer beneath the turf. Henry County clay can trap water, so proper base construction prevents pooling. That's why a professional installation—not a DIY approach—makes all the difference in Stockbridge yards.
Most Stockbridge residential jobs range from $8 to $12 per square foot, depending on turf quality and site conditions. A standard quarter-acre lawn usually runs $3,500 to $6,000. We offer veteran discounts that can meaningfully reduce that cost. Pricing factors include clay prep work and how much existing sod needs removal.
